If there is one thing I had then it is Nyctophobia which is the extreme fear of darkness. Most people love dark places. Some people will prefer to sleep in the dark and can not sleep if the light is on. Well, I wasn’t those people. I had a severe fear of darkness. Whenever it is nighttime, if there is no power supply, I try to turn on my torchlight or my phone light.

I couldn’t sleep without light and I wouldn’t enter a dark place, I always had my lights on. My friends already knew the kind of person I was so whenever I came to sleep over, they tried to keep the light on since I was scared of the dark and I couldn’t stay in a dark place.

Well, I realized how discomforting this was for my friends if there happened to be any sleepover, they always kept the light on for me. I couldn’t stay in a dark place. In a way, I felt embarrassed and I needed to face my fears.
The first night I decided to sleep in darkness and turn off my light, it wasn’t up to 30 minutes I turned on my lights again because I was so scared of the dark and kept having thoughts of something terrible happening.

I had to force myself and I started with 30 minutes of staying in the dark to 1 hour of staying in the dark and I kept increasing it as the days went by because I needed to face my fear and stop being scared of the dark as nothing was going to happen. It took a while before I finally adapted to staying in the dark and then I could stay in the dark without having dark thoughts.

D86E0855-8610-4AE9-B4B6-CB4D70B62A19.jpeg

After I was done facing my fears, I spent the night at my friend's place and she was shocked when I told her “I now sleep in the dark”. Well, she didn’t believe it until I turned off the light myself and I finally stayed without going back to turn it on.

I try to avoid anything that will give me scary thoughts like horror movies which will bring back the effect of me not being able to stay in the dark. This way I tend to keep my mind intact and stay in a dark room without me running out or turning on my lights. Fears are limiting and the best thing is to erase them from our mindset
